NYU Arthur L. Carter Journalism Institute

Livewire Exclusives is a clearinghouse for finished stories and pitches from recent master's graduates of New York University's Arthur L. Carter Journalism Institute, available to editors on an exclusive basis. Editors should communicate and negotiate directly with the writers. When a writer advises us of an assignment or placement, we'll remove the listing. The writers also request a three-day turnaround on any offered query or story.

Free Subscriptions

Editors may request our biweekly story budget, at livewire@journalism.nyu.edu
